Tacubaya vs Portage La Prairie, Mb Climate & Distance Between

Canada flag
  • The distance between Tacubaya, Mexico and Portage La Prairie, Mb, Canada is approximately 3,392 km or 2,108 mi.
  • To reach Tacubaya in this distance one would set out from Portage La Prairie, Mb bearing 181.7° or S and follow the great circles arc to approach Tacubaya bearing 181.2° or S .
  • Tacubaya has a subtropical highland climate with dry winters (Cwb) whereas Portage La Prairie, Mb has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
  • Both are in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
  • The average annual temperature is 13.2 °C (23.8°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 31.8 °C (57.2°F) less in Tacubaya.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to truly continental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 322.5 mm (12.7 in) more which is equivalent to 322.5 l/m² (7.91 US gal/ft²) or 3,225,000 l/ha (344,774 US gal/ac) more. About 1 3/5 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 29.4° higher in Tacubaya than in Portage La Prairie, Mb.
